Identifying Indications of Roof Covering Damage and Put On



Acknowledging the signs of roofing damages and wear is important for maintaining the stability of a structure's structure. Homeowners and structure managers ought to seek several indications that recommend a roofing system might need interest. Missing out on, cracked, or curled shingles are a clear indication of degeneration. Visible spots or dark touches triggered by algae or moss can also indicate underlying moisture problems that might bring about additional damage if not attended to. An additional vital signs and symptom to watch for is the presence of extreme granules in rain gutters; this usually symbolizes innovative shingle wear. Additionally, any indications of drooping or architectural contortion needs to prompt immediate professional assessment, as these could be indications of serious structural problems requiring immediate repair service.
